Output ddcc0768d49147f02ebe593633752c47e07aff2b5fa0d826f51e8e3ca9d0eb55:884

value
3664958
script pubkey
OP_0 OP_PUSHBYTES_20 ef968b173e13f43893afd9de93bd3eb8f35cf16a
address
bc1qa7tgk9e7z06r3ya0m80f80f7hre4eut26tdu7l
transaction
ddcc0768d49147f02ebe593633752c47e07aff2b5fa0d826f51e8e3ca9d0eb55
confirmations
165727
spent
true